Crush It With Con(FIT)Dence: The Missing Ingredient in Your Fitness Journey

By Uplift WorldWide

We hear it all the time: "Success comes down to discipline." And while discipline is absolutely important, there is another ingredient that often gets overlooked (confidence).

Confidence is what gets you through the gym doors when you're intimidated. It's what helps you believe that your goals are possible before you see any results. It's what allows you to keep showing up when the scale isn't moving, when progress feels slow, or when life gets busy.

The truth is, many people don't quit because they lack ability. They quit because somewhere along the way, they stopped believing they could succeed.

Are You Showing Up Confidently?

Think about your last workout.

Did you walk in with your head held high, ready to give your best effort?

Or did you walk in feeling defeated, discouraged, or simply going through the motions?

Maybe you're frustrated because you haven't seen results fast enough. Maybe you're comparing yourself to someone else. Maybe you've convinced yourself that you don't have enough time, enough knowledge, or enough experience to succeed.

These thoughts are more common than you think. But often, they all stem from the same root issue: a lack of confidence in your ability to achieve your goals.

Confidence Changes the Game

Showing up with confidence can completely transform your fitness journey.

Confidence allows you to:

  • Attempt the workout you thought was too hard

  • Pick up the heavier weight

  • Walk into a new fitness class

  • Stay committed even when results aren't immediate

  • Believe that your future self is worth the effort

The power of manifestation is often connected to confidence. You can dream about your goals all day long, but you'll only take action toward them if you believe you're capable of achieving them.

Discipline helps you stay consistent.

Confidence helps you get started and keep going.

The Good News: Confidence Can Be Built

Confidence isn't something you're born with. It's something you develop through intentional action, positive self-talk, and repeated success.

If you're ready to build confidence and crush your fitness goals, start with these five strategies.

5 Tips for Building Fitness Confidence

1. Set Ambitious Goals and Track Progress

Big goals can be exciting, but they can also feel overwhelming.

Break them into smaller milestones and celebrate every victory along the way.

Did you go from one push-up to two?

Did you walk for ten minutes when last month you couldn't find the motivation to start?

That's progress.

Confidence grows when you acknowledge how far you've come.

2. Develop a Healthy Body Image

Many people spend too much time criticizing their bodies and not enough time appreciating them.

When you catch yourself comparing your journey to someone else's, pause and remind yourself:

"My body does amazing things."

Your body carries you through every workout, every challenge, and every victory. Speak to it with kindness and respect.

3. Face What You're Avoiding

What's the thing you're avoiding at the gym?

Is it strength training?

Group fitness classes?

The squat rack?

The treadmill?

Whatever it is, that's probably where your confidence needs to grow the most.

Challenge yourself to do that thing safely and intentionally. Growth happens when we step outside our comfort zones.

4. Say It Until You Slay It

Words matter.

The conversations you have with yourself can either build confidence or destroy it.

Create fitness affirmations and say them often:

  • I am strong.

  • I am capable.

  • I am becoming healthier every day.

  • I can do hard things.

  • My goals are achievable.

Speak life into your journey.

5. Feed Your Mind Before You Train Your Body

Confidence starts in the mind.

Before your workout, listen to something that inspires you:

  • A motivational speech

  • An empowering podcast

  • Your favorite high-energy playlist

  • An audiobook that challenges you to think bigger

Let those words ignite your confidence before you step into action.
